3 Business Compromise Business Compromise (BEC) a.k.a., Whale Phishing, Masquerading, or The CEO Criminals stole ~$750m from more than 7,000 U.S. businesses, Oct Aug Combined with international victims, FBI estimates that more than $1.2b has been lost due to BEC scams Majority of transfers going to banks in China and Hong Kong 3

4 Business Compromise May not be able to obtain insurance coverage for the loss New version of BEC scam: Fraudster contacts businesses via phone or posing as a lawyer handling confidential or time-sensitive information. Pressures victim to act quickly, perhaps even secretly, in transferring funds. Typically at the end of the business day or work week, to coincide with the close of business of international FIs. 4

5 FBI best practices: Implement a detection system that flags s with extensions similar to the company . E.g., if your legitimate company is the would be flagged. Don t rely solely on spam filters to catch these s. Krebs: Business Compromise» Spoofed s used in BEC scams are unlikely to set off spam traps because the targets are not mass ed.» And criminals sending them take the time to research the target organization s relationships, activities, interests, and travel and purchasing plans. Register all company domains that are similar to the actual company domain. 5

6 Business Compromise Verify changes in vendor payment locations by adding additional two-factor authentication. E.g., have a secondary sign-off by company personnel Confirm requests for funds transfers. When using phone verification, use previously-known numbers, not the numbers provided in an request Know the habits of your customers when it comes to payment habits and amounts; flag anything out of the ordinary. Carefully scrutinize all requests for funds transfers to determine if the requests are legitimate. 6

7 If victimized: Business Compromise Immediately contact your bank and request that they contact the corresponding FI where the transfer was sent. Contact your FBI office if the transfer is recent. The FBI, working with FinCEN, might be able to help return or freeze the funds. File a detailed complaint with Be sure to identify the incident as a BEC scam. 9 EMV EMV = Europay, MasterCard, and Visa Global standard for credit & debit payments using chip cards Chip cards, chip and PIN cards, and smart cards Cards include a microchip that sends a dynamic protected value unique to each transaction. Dynamic Data vs. Static Data Reduction in counterfeit card present fraud Cloning a chip card is virtually impossible

13 EMV Most FIs issuing chip-and-signature Lost/stolen and card-not-received EMV can address this, if chip-and-pin U.S. is chip-and-choice ; most cards are being issued as chip-andsignature With chip and signature, fraudster can steal mail and use card without knowing PIN Will EMV implementation in the US lead to a rise in instances of non-receipt of mail?

14 EMV Brian Krebs, KrebsonSecurity.com, Aug. 2015, reported a shimmer found on an ATM in Mexico Shimmer: A thin device that sits between the card s chip and the chip reader when the cardholder inserts ( dips ) the card into the slot. Like a skimmer on a POS card readers, fuel pumps or ATM that steals mag-stripe payment card info The shimmer reported by Krebs was easily inserted into the ATM and reportedly could capture EMV card data. SOURCE: Does a Shimmer on a Mexican ATM Portend a Fraud Threat to U.S. EMV Chip Cards? by Jim Daly, Digital Transactions News, Aug. 13, 2015

26 Near Field Communication (NFC) Short-range wireless RFID technology As opposed to longer range used for toll tags, for example Credit/debit card info provisioned to the mobile wallet Credit/debit card information are encrypted and stored in a secure element (SE) in the phone (as opposed to in the cloud ) SE is often an embedded chip controlled by the handset manufacturer, or the SIM card, which is controlled by the mobile carrier Limited number of merchants are NFC-enabled Potential drivers of NFC upgrade at merchant POS: EMV; Apple Pay

28 Apple Pay Uses iphone s TouchID fingerprint scanner as a form of authentication introduced in the previous iphone model, 5s built into iphone s home button iphone 6 has a new chip, a secure element (SE), in the phone handset Stores the cardholder s payment information though not the actual card number Image credit: Apple Inc.

29 Apple Pay Automatically uses consumer s card on file with itunes as default payment account Users add additional cards by scanning them with the phone s camera, or typing card details into Passbook app Apple verifies card account data with card issuer and places a digital rendering of the card in Passbook

30 Apple Pay Apple provides card issuing FI with information to help validate a new card: Potential customer s device name Current location Whether or not the customer has a long history of transactions within itunes Issuing FI decides if additional verification is needed Apple ios Security Guide. Depending on what is offered by the card issuer, the user may be able to choose between different options for additional verification, such as a text message, , customer service call, or a method in an approved thirdparty app to complete the verification.

31 An FI might: Apple Pay Card Validation Ask cardholder to enter additional data to confirm his identity. Require cardholders to log into their online accounts to authorize Apple Pay. Asked cardholder to call customer-service rep to set up the card e.g., Wells Fargo: Requires some customers to provide additional verification to add a card. Customers are directed to call in to verify or to download the Wells Fargo Verify app. The app guides the customer through the verification process.

32 Apple Pay Apple Pay uses tokenization to remove payment card numbers from the transaction process. When a user adds a card, Apple does not store the actual card number Instead, creates a device-only account number for each card and stores it in the phone s SE Each time Apple Pay is used, Apple uses a one-time payment number, along with a dynamic security code Essentially, creates a one-time card use system, and Eliminates the need for static security code (CVV/CVC) on the plastic card Merchant never sees the cardholder s name, card number or security code

33 Apple Pay To make a payment using his default card, user does not need to open an app or wake the phone, because of the NFC antenna Holds iphone near merchant s contactless card reader Uses Touch ID (home button) to authenticate by fingerprint A subtle vibration and beep indicate payment information has been sent If user wants to pay with a card other than his default card, he must first open the Passbook app and select an alternate card

34 Apple Pay Fees Card-issuing FIs pay a per-transaction fee to Apple to be included in Apple Pay 15bps on credit cards transactions $.005 on debit card transaction

44 Mobile ATM Transactions Fidelity (FIS) piloting a mobile app that facilitates cardless ATM withdrawals Customer queues up an ATM transaction in mobile app before arriving at ATM ATM displays a QR code User scans QR code to complete the transaction Combats skimming Speeds up transactions: At ATM, 7-10 seconds per transaction as opposed to more than 45 seconds traditionally
